With the subscription, you get access to the entire Creative Suite 6 Master Collection, 20GB of online storage, complete device to computer sync capability, services like Business Catalyst for Web hosting and Typekit for Web fonts, the Digital Publishing Suite Single Edition, all the mobile Touch apps, and eventually, services such as community, training, and support. With a year’s subscription, Creative Cloud will be available to individual designers and artists for $50 per month ($600 annually), and later to creative teams for $70 per month ($840 annually).

“You can’t just wrap up everything in a box and ship it on a disk-that’s not the way it works because specs and standards change rapidly,” said Scott Morris, senior marketing director of Adobe’s creative pro business. Adobe sees Creative Cloud as a vehicle for solving the creative community’s digital publishing dilemma and helping users effectively deliver content to every medium.įor that task, desktop tools alone are no longer going to cut it. Eventually, it will also offer tools for sharing, training, and community. It will include new products and services, new features as they become available, and new resources to assist creatives in defining effective workflows.
With Adobe is gearing up for a fresh Creative Suite extravaganza, there’s an open question for all creatives: Stick with Creative Suite or take a chance on Creative Cloud?Īdobe sees the Creative Cloud as Creative Suite 6 with benefits. Not only will Adobe CS6 be released simultaneously with the new Creative Cloud, it will constitute the main component of Creative Cloud. With the launch of Creative Suite 6 now on the horizon, Adobe is tying its major product line into its overall cloud strategy. Meantime, Adobe has also confirmed that a new upgrade of its massive Creative Suite will also be released at the same time. The buzz around Creative Cloud, which began last fall, has gained momentum as its designated launch time approaches-within the first half, and before the summer of 2012, at a date yet to be announced. That’s because Adobe sees the cloud as the future-its primary delivery system for software, services, social networking, community, and ultimately, increased value to its customers. Adobe has its head in the cloud and it wants you to, as well.
